Verse in context — Mark 12
‹And at the season he sent to the husbandmen a servant, that he might receive from the husbandmen of the fruit of the vineyard.›
‹And they caught› [him], ‹and beat him, and sent› [him] ‹away empty.›
‹And again he sent unto them another servant; and at him they cast stones, and wounded› [him] ‹in the head, and sent› [him] ‹away shamefully handled.›
‹And again he sent another; and him they killed, and many others; beating some, and killing some.›
‹Having yet therefore one son, his wellbeloved, he sent him also last unto them, saying, They will reverence my son.›
